There's a magical emporium where toys come to life and wonder fills the air, but only a few know the secret behind its magic. This place isn't just a toy store—it's a gateway to adventures that stretch the limits of imagination. And that's only the beginning.

Quick Assessment

This novelization of 'Mr. Magorium's Wonder Emporium' brings the enchanting story of a magical toy store to young readers aged 9-12. It features themes of fantasy and magic with a focus on imagination and wonder, suitable for middle-grade readers. Parents should note it is a gentle, whimsical story with no significant content concerns.

Why we rated Mr. Magorium's Wonder Emporium 9C

Mr. Magorium's Wonder Emporium is written at a Level 4-5 reading level across 128 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 5.5 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Mr. Magorium's Wonder Emporium works for readers up to grade 6.5.

We rate Mr. Magorium's Wonder Emporium as 9C ("Clear") because the content sits in the "Gentle" range — no conflict beyond everyday childhood experiences.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ly gentle; no single dimension stands out as a concern.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the gentle intensity score.

Thematically, Mr. Magorium's Wonder Emporium explores fantasy world-building, adventure, friendship, and media tie-in —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
